Am I at ease at this moment?

This past year, my life has been like a roller coaster overcoming many challenges (I will come back to that word later in my post): health issues (of my partner), buy and sell of two houses which have caused three different moves (and you all know what a move implies, right?), multiple visits to the hospital for my elderly mother (540 km away) , and more recently the loss of my beloved Skye. As you go go go, you do not necessarily take the time to BE in the moment, in the present. So I just reopened Eckhart Tolle’s book Practicing the Power of Now. He says: Presence is the key to Freedom, so you can only be free now. This sits so well! I found myself alone (not lonely) for the past 15 days and it reminded me of my days in Barbados. Time of reflection, time to witness my mental and emotional state. Am I in the moment? How do I feel? What do I feel? Why? What thoughts do I have? Why? I came to re-member Acceptance of what is, without judging it. I have to admit, it is not all-ways easy. I am guilty of it too. I found myself with a particular thought, and just reacted on it. The feeling that you get is usually never good. Being the witness of your thoughts, allows for peace and stops you in an action-reaction attitude. As the past lives inside of you, you can either react from there or act from the present.. You will definitely get a different outcome. The Unknown is so so much better!

In my book SOAR with Vulnerability I talk about the “Security of the Unknown versus the Security of the Known“. As you read this simple phrase, don’t you feel the limitation of the second option? For me it is so huge. Imagine if you would live in the known all the time?! How boring it would be. No more discovery to make, no more exploration, no more adventure, no more wondering or questioning, no more opportunity to grow and expand. You know it all after all! You have already created this comfort zone space where there is no more place for anything else. Your blackboard is filled with formulas and information, beliefs and habits that define your life. On the other side, the Unknown is the most exciting and creative playground. There are no rules or limitations of what can be done.  The sky is the limit! And of course it is LOL. As you let anything and everything that wants to unfold, unfold. You are called to step outside of your comfort zone? It is because you can.  When you engage in the playground of the unknown, it creates different and stimulating experiences for expansion. Expansion to your ultimate place of knowing. So next time before saying no to a new experience, embrace the opportunity to get closer to your higher knowing. Until then, be happy and excited to say: I don’t know. Authenticity is the New Sexy!

  If that is true, why is there so many people still hiding behind this big tempered glass? Honestly I don’t know why! But what I do know,  is that the people who are still standing behind that glass are the ones missing on their lives, their gifts, their blessings and true love. Not true love as finding the perfect mate or soul mate but as finding their true selves. The true meaning of embracing your Authentic Vulnerability is about being transparent at all time. Transparent means to be clear, honest, integrous and in full harmony with who you are. Not some of the time but ALL of the time. It is about being true/transparent to yourself  at all time. Have you ever found yourself in a situation where you were invited to a party, family reunion, business event, etc….where your true self did not want to go? It doesn’t matter why. What matters is that your true self did not want to participate in this particular life experience.  Nevertheless you put up your suit, entered your tempered glass and went along for the ride. Not listening to your higher self and your intuition, you went along pretending that you wanted to be there, pretending to enjoy a situation or even people that you did not feel like being with at this particular moment. Oye! Why? Why do we do this? Why do we this to ourself and to others? Why do we go against the grain of our natural beingness? I can promise you that from the moment you stop playing that game, your whole surrounding will change along with you.
